Alligator Woman is not only their best album,I think it contains three of their strongest singles...

***"Just Be Yourself"---Contains a groove that's so infectious,they recyled it a year later on the song "Style".

***"Alligator Woman"---This track introduced a whole new sound/style for Cameo! On this slammin' track,they add New Wave elements to their brand of punk funk and the results are outrageous.This should have been their big crossover hit,but they had to wait a few years later for that ("Word Up").

***"Flirt"---classic Cameo funk right here!

As much as I love Alligator Woman. I think their 80s sound sounds more dated than their late 70s to 78 sound. It has something to do with a bit overkill of similar claps, synths, effects etc... it's a fun album. But personally I prefer them from 78-80 sound wise. Not saying my opinion is more right than anyone else. Just how I prefer it. Same reason I tend to think Prince started to sound less creative with the drum machine after he had experimented alot on 1999 and Purple Rain. After a while stuff starts sounding a bit like a cliche.
